Marshals believe wanted Zetas member may be hiding in Valley
December 16, 2009 10:16 PM
Ana Ley
The Monitor
GOT A TIP?>> Anyone with information about the whereabouts of purported Zetas member Joseph Allen GarcĂ*a is urged to call (800) 336-0102.
McALLEN — One of the country’s most wanted criminals — a purported member of the Zetas — may be hiding in the Rio Grande Valley, officials said Wednesday.
According to a news release issued by the U.S. Marshals Service, Joseph Allen GarcĂ*a is suspected of attacking a group inside a Laredo residence with an AK-47 rifle in December 2003, killing 18-year-old Mario Gonzalez and injuring three others.
GarcĂ*a was arrested in connection with the shooting but was later released on bond.
The next year, he allegedly shot a teen during an argument. GarcĂ*a was briefly jailed but again posted bond and was released. The teen eventually died from his injuries, and GarcĂ*a was again charged with murder.
Four months later, authorities arrested him on drug charges.
GarcĂ*a failed to appear in court in March 2005 in connection with his criminal charges and has been on the run ever since then.
Authorities believe the 21-year-old is associated with the Mexican Mafia as well as the Zetas, a paramilitary criminal organization that served as the enforcement arm of the Gulf Cartel but now operates as an independent cartel.
